Beloved, we should love each other. Because love is of God, and every man who loves has been begotten of God, and knows God. He who does not love does not know God, because God is love. By this the love of God was made known in us, because God sent his Son, the only begotten, into the world so that we might live through him. read more.
In this is love, not that we loved God, but that he loved us, and sent his Son, an atonement for our sins. Beloved, if God so loved us, we also are obligated to love each other. No man has ever seen God. If we love each other, God abides in us, and his love is in us, having been fully perfected. In this we know that we abide in him and he in us, because he has given us from his Spirit. And we have seen and testify that the Father has sent the Son, a Savior of the world. Whoever acknowledges that Jesus is the Son of God, God abides in him, and he in God. And we know, and have believed the love that God has in us. God is love, and he who abides in love abides in God, and God abides in him. By this love has been fully perfected with us, so that we may have boldness in the day of judgment, because just as that man is, we also are in this world. Fear is not in love, but perfect love casts out fear, because fear holds punishment, and he who is afraid has not been fully perfected in love. We love him, because he first loved us. If any man says, I love God, and hates his brother, he is a liar. For he who does not love his brother whom he has seen, how can he love God whom he has not seen? And we have this commandment from him, so that he who loves God will also love his brother.
